Definitions
-
Of or relating to both the Indo-European and the Semitic languages, or to a proposed ancestor of both. not-comparable
-
Of or relating to India and Semitic peoples; for example, of or relating to Semitic (or supposedly Semitic) peoples of India. not-comparable
